Film 350

Film Genre examines the conventions, development, and cultural contexts of a rotating selection of film genres, with a focus on the stylistic innovations, recurrent themes, and varying interpretations of representative films and/or filmmakers. Repeatable with change of instructor.

Other Requirements: PREREQ: ENGLISH 102 OR ENGLISH 162 OR ENGLISH 105
